HB 2613
Providing for the crime victims compensation board to establish fees chargeable for conducting examinations of persons who may be victims of sexual assault, authorizing the board to adopt rules and regulations to administer such fees and to use moneys in the crime victims compensation fund for the payment of such fees and allowing certain exceptions to the confidentiality of records and information given to the board.

Roll-call votes on this bill
| Question | Chamber | Result | Yea | Nay | Other | Date | Source |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| House Concurred with amendments in conference - Yea: 96 Nay: 27 | lower | pass | 96 | 26 | 2 | Mar 27, 2026 | LegiScan API LegiScan-ToS |
| Senate Emergency Final Action - Passed as amended - Yea: 40 Nay: 0 | upper | pass | 39 | 0 | 0 | Mar 19, 2026 | LegiScan API LegiScan-ToS |
| House Emergency Final Action - Passed - Yea: 112 Nay: 4 | lower | pass | 110 | 4 | 9 | Feb 19, 2026 | LegiScan API LegiScan-ToS |
